Output 5376c3f8fcd9c91cca6b05d726cfef147abf3ede6950ca572df979c30225716e:2

value
8027307254
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 27509252622d0f7aec14099bee64b067d2adb4a1235afb30a541a5d39fb6f150
address
tb1pyagfy5nz958h4mq5pxd7ue9svlf2md9pydd0kv99gxja88ak79gqnpe937
transaction
5376c3f8fcd9c91cca6b05d726cfef147abf3ede6950ca572df979c30225716e
confirmations
78249
spent
true